The decision to have children is often clouded by fears and uncertainties. Many potential parents worry about financial strains, time commitments, and the impact on their lifestyle. It's common to hear thoughts like 'I can't afford to have kids' or 'I didn’t have great parents,' which can create a mental barrier to starting a family. However, it's essential to recognize that these concerns can often be addressed with proper planning and support. Consider evaluating your financial readiness by creating a budget that includes potential expenses related to childcare, education, and healthcare. This can provide clarity on how to manage finances effectively with children in the picture. Additionally, think about time management; while children do change your life significantly, many parents find creative ways to balance work, personal life, and parenting. Furthermore, seek out parenting communities online or in person which can be invaluable for support and advice. Engaging with other parents can offer insights and encouragement that may help mitigate fears about parenting.
